I think LDAP is the right way for us. We do not want to conenct to customers own authentication services, we are planning to use our own authentication service for vCloud Director, and to be more precise for TrendMicro Deep Security + EMC Avamar.

All of them offer LDAP support, we just have to figure out if they supprt AD LDS. vCloud Director seems to be the most flexible solution. The only concern that remains is that we have to provide the users a possibility to change their passwords. I have not tested it, but i doubt that changing a ldap user password from vCloud Director is possible ;-)

I am able to extend the API of vCloud Director to update the user credentials, but that still requires some webbased user interface. And that is something we can't do. At least not in a way that it looks nice :-(
